A career in the Creative Industries for Churcher’s College OC Vanessa Pearson

Posted on 25th Oct 2019 in School News, Alumni, Awards, Careers guidance

​Vanessa Pearson left Churcher’s College in 2016 to go to the Arts University Bournemouth to pursue her passion for art and design. This summer Vanessa graduated with a First Class BA (Hons) degree in Modelmaking and the highest grade in her year. She was also awarded the ‘Dean’s Prize for the School of Art, Design and Architecture’ at her graduation ceremony.

Equestrian success for Cranleigh School

Posted on 23rd Oct 2019 in School News, Achievements, Competition, Sport

​Cranleigh riders stormed their way to four national team titles, two individual National titles, one team silver, one individual silver and four more top eight placings at the NSEA National Championships held over four days at Addington Manor in Buckinghamshire last weekend. With 250 schools from England, Scotland and Wales competing with 1000 competitors between them, it was an outcome that we certainly had not predicted!

Five gold medals for Churcher's College at the Royal Society of Biology Junior Challenge

Posted on 22nd Oct 2019 in School News, Achievements, Competition, Science, Student awards

Five GCSE biology students at Churcher’s College have successfully won gold medals at the Royal Society of Biology (RSB) annual Biology Junior Challenge competition. The victorious students are Josiah Wilson, Mara James, Jack Foremen, Oliver Fogelin and Jasper Jones. Nearly 50,000 students from across the world take part in the RSB Junior Competition and only the top 5% achieve a Gold Medal.
